just look at the rates on your next electric bill don't pay attention to the first 1000 kilowatt hours if you use more than a that already. just pay attention to the " above 1000 kilowatt hours" rate.

simple formula is

watts/1000 x electric hours running x 30

so for example:

400w/1000= .4

.4 x .08 x 18 x 30 = $17.28

So where I live it would cost me around $17 to $20 to run a 400 watt high pressure sodium 18 hours a day for a month.
